On Tue, 2016-09-20 at 15:26 +0200, KOVACS Krisztian wrote:
> The introduction of TCP_NEW_SYN_RECV state, and the addition of request
> sockets to the ehash table seems to have broken the --transparent option
> of the socket match for IPv6 (around commit a9407000).
> 
> Now that the socket lookup finds the TCP_NEW_SYN_RECV socket instead of the
> listener, the --transparent option tries to match on the no_srccheck flag
> of the request socket.
> 
> Unfortunately, that flag was only set for IPv4 sockets in tcp_v4_init_req()
> by copying the transparent flag of the listener socket. This effectively
> causes '-m socket --transparent' not match on the ACK packet sent by the
> client in a TCP handshake.
> 
> This change adds the same code initializing no_srccheck to
> tcp_v6_init_req(), rendering the above scenario working again.
>

Thanks a lot for the bug hunting guys.

Could you add the precise tag to help stable backports ?

Fixes: 12-digit-sha1 ("patch title")

Since it is a netdev patch, I would also copy netdev@ (done here)

Also what about moving this (IPv4/IPv6 common code) before the
af_ops->init_req(req, sk, skb); call, since it is no longer family
specific ?
